Hiking Trail Conditions Report
Peaks
Peaks Mt. Starr King, Mt. Waumbek, NH
Trails
Trails: Starr King Trail
Date of Hike
Date of Hike: Saturday, March 26, 2022
Parking/Access Road Notes
Parking/Access Road Notes: Parking lot was full as we had just finished Cabot and drove over to Waumbek for noon 
Surface Conditions
Surface Conditions: Ice - Blue, Standing/Running Water on Trail, Snow/Ice - Frozen Granular, Slush 
Recommended Equipment
Recommended Equipment: Light Traction 
Water Crossing Notes
Water Crossing Notes: Nothing worth noting. A few towards the base that were easily hoppable and good water sources if needed

Comments
Comments: Beautiful day to hike Waumbek! More spring feel on Waumbek than on Cabot for sure. The lower elevation is slush and mud and getting close to a full monorail. The slush then takes over as you climb before the winter stronghold at higher elevations. There are some sections of ice and mostly hard packed snow. The Trail is perfect up top and microspikes were the only thing needed throughout. The trail from Starr King to Waumbek was so nice, packed down, and pleasant to hike that it took no time at all to hike the mile section. If you plan on continuing along the Kilkenny Ridge trail, I would plan on having snowshoes.
